Toxicology results on Offaly girl 'could take two weeks'

Gardaí investigating the suspicious death of an 11-year-old girl in Co Offaly have said that it could take up to two weeks to get back the toxicology results, which should establish how she died.

A post mortem examination on the body of Emily Scully, from Tullamore, proved inconclusive.
